I. SUGGESTIONS FOR SELECTION OF CONTESTANTS
A. Contact local High School Principals, Music or Drama Teachers, Church Youth Choir or Private Voice Teachers in you area, for names of possible candidates, or
B. Schedule a club program/competition with judges from high schools, local voice teachers, church youth directors, youth choir directors, or club members; a great program; or
C. Encourage high schools to have a competition and send winners to club to perform for one of your programs

III. LOCATION AND TIME OF THE COMPETITION:
SHEWAN RECITAL HALL SATURDAY January 10, 2010 At 1:30 PM
FIRST, SECOND, and THIRD PLACE WINNERS WILL PERFORM AT THE DISTRICT 7120 CONFERENCE
IV. AWARDS
PARTICIPANTS RECEIVE CERTIFICATES, AND A WRITTEN COPY OF THEIR ADJUDICATION FROM PROFESSIONAL ADJUDICATORS.
FIRST, SECOND, and THIRD PLACE WINNERS WILL RECEIVE THE ABOVE PLUS CASH AWARDS ( $1000.00 1ST PRIZE, $500.00 2ND PRIZE, $300.00 3RD PRIZE ) ROBERTS WESLEYAN COLLEGE WILL GRANT A SCHOLARSHIP TO THE 1ST PLACE WINNER IF HE/SHE DECIDES TO ATTEND ROBERTS. THE ONE TIME AWARD WILL BE $6000.00
V. ELIGIBILITY
THE CONTEST IS OPEN TO YOUNG JUNIORS OR SENIORS HIGH SCHOOL MEN AND WOMEN, LOCATED WITHIN THE ROTARY DISTRICT 7120.
DESCRIPTION OF THE SINGER OF THE YEAR PROGRAM
The program is designed to encourage high school students as they develop the art of solo singing. EACH CLUB IS RESPONSIBLE FOR SELECTING THE CANDIDATES IT WISHES TO SPONSOR.
COMPETITION 2 contrasting selections. At least one must be from the the NYSSMA Maual, Grade V or VL (Available at your local High School)
ACCOMPANIST: a solo pianist should accompany All selections. The singer may provide their own or one will be provided on the day of the competition. RWC provides excellent accompanists, but they must have the music 2 weeks prior to the competition. ABSOLUTELY NO TAPED ACCOMPANIMENT
SHEET MUSIC: A single copy of all selections must be provided for the adjudication on the day of competition. All music will be returned immediately following the event. ABSOLUTELY NO PHOTOCOPIES WILL BE ACCEPTED.
JUDGES: PRELIMINARY COMPETITION IS AT THE DISCRETION OF THE LOCAL Rotary Club FINAL COMPETITION WILL BE adjudicated by professional vocalists from the upstate New York region EACH CONTESTANT WILL SING THEIR TWO CONTRASTING SELECTIONS.
